のくす牧場
コンテンツ
牧場内検索
カウンタ
総計:127,092,555人
昨日:no data人
今日:
最近の注目
人気の最安値情報

    私的良スレ書庫

    不明な単語は2ch用語を / 要望・削除依頼は掲示板へ。不適切な画像報告もこちらへどうぞ。 / 管理情報はtwitter
    ログインするとレス評価できます。 登録ユーザには一部の画像が表示されますので、問題のある画像や記述を含むレスに「禁」ボタンを押してください。

    元スレ【PHP】下らねぇ質問はID出して書き込みやがれ 85

    php スレッド一覧へ / php とは? / 携帯版 / dat(gz)で取得 / トップメニュー
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。
    レスフィルター : (試験中)
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itter
    452 : nobodyさん - 2009/07/11(土) 16:07:56 ID:EDbsXnZV (-28,+25,+0)
    >>450
    専ブラのsageチェック外すの忘れていました。
    すいません。
    459 : nobodyさん - 2009/07/11(土) 18:45:45 ID:??? (+3,-27,-11)
    >457
    PHPのバージョン情報とかは絶対レン鯖のFAQだからまずそっち調べろカス
    461 : nobodyさん - 2009/07/11(土) 23:25:33 ID:EDbsXnZV (-22,+27,+0)
    すいません。できました。
    皆さん、ありがとうございました。
    463 : nobodyさん - 2009/07/12(日) 07:51:57 ID:??? (+57,+29,-26)
    変数はきちんと初期化して使うのがくだらないバグを避ける一つの手
    464 : nobodyさん - 2009/07/12(日) 08:18:43 ID:??? (-1,-29,-6)
    isset使わないと、E-Noticeが出るよね?
    465 : nobodyさん - 2009/07/12(日) 08:58:12 ID:??? (+0,-28,-16)
    issetを使わないからじゃなくて、undefinedだからでしょ?
    466 : nobodyさん - 2009/07/12(日) 11:40:20 ID:??? (+34,-30,-29)
    if(isset($hoge))
    if(!empty($hoge))
    if($hoge != "")
    if($hoge <> "")

    どれが一番良いの?
    467 : nobodyさん - 2009/07/12(日) 11:44:58 ID:??? (+67,+30,-294)
    そういう書き方をすると、Noticeを切らざるを得ない。
    ($hogeが初期化されていない事がある、という前提で)
    そしてNoticeを切っていると、もっと複雑な場所のバグに気づかなくなるかもしれない。
    エラーメッセージなしでコーディングするのは、懐中電灯だけで暗闇を歩くようなもの。
    電気のスイッチが壁にくっついてるなら、点けておくに越した事はない。

    速度は気にしない。
    バグを未然に防ぐ事と、0.1msにも満たない処理速度の向上を天秤にかけて、後者を取るのは無能なアマチュアだけ。
    つうか、そんな細かい処理の速度が気になるような状況なら、そもそもPHPを使う、という事自体大間違いだしな。
    書き方で迷った時は、基本的に常に「速度が速いか」じゃなくて「バグを見つけやすいか」「コードを読みやすいか」で判断するべき。

    >466
    そもそも意味が違う。
    $hogeに0、null、空文字列("")を代入した場合、$hogeを初期化しない場合、の4パターンで実行結果がどう違うか試してみれ。
    468 : nobodyさん - 2009/07/12(日) 12:08:06 ID:??? (+57,+29,-29)
    早いからという理由で三項演算子をネストしまくってバグを入れたり、書いてるうちに
    訳がわからなくなったとか言ってたりするのはもう見てらんない
    469 : nobodyさん - 2009/07/12(日) 16:05:02 ID:D+DGjsUg (+24,+29,-19)
    >>458
    >>459
    ありがとうございます、ところがFAQにもどこにも乗っていないんですよね・・・。
    ちなみにここttp://www.i-paradise.nu/です
    どちらにせよ今の関数が使えないということは諦めないとダメですよね?
    代替用の関数とかありませんよね?
    470 : nobodyさん - 2009/07/12(日) 16:29:39 ID:??? (+3,-30,-178)
    documentrootの外にあるjpgを出力させるプログラムを書いたんですが動きません(画面真っ白になります)
    どこがおかしいのでしょうか。。

    <?php
    include_once "config.inc.php";
    i18n_http_output("pass");
    header("Content-type: image/jpg");

    echo "<html><body>";
    echo "<img src='";
    readfile(_HOGE_DIR."123.jpg");
    echo "' />";
    echo "</body></html>";
    ?>

    定数_HOGE_DIR は保存用ディレクトリ /var/www/hoge/を出力 します
    画像のパーミッションは644でも755でもダメでした
    よろしくお願いします

    参考にした情報はここの一番下です
    http://www.stackasterisk.jp/tech/php/php02_01.jsp
    475 : nobodyさん - 2009/07/12(日) 17:46:13 ID:??? (-7,-29,-4)
    とりあえずi18n_http_output("pass"); を外せ
    476 : nobodyさん - 2009/07/12(日) 17:49:29 ID:eWzEgYjh (-20,+29,-13)
    >>475
    どひゃー! うまくいきました!
    これで作業が進みます、ありがとうございました!
    あの一行は何だったんでしょうか、意味もわからず書いてましたが
    477 : nobodyさん - 2009/07/12(日) 17:58:56 ID:??? (+57,+29,-3)
    自分で意味のわからない関数を書く男の人って……
    478 : nobodyさん - 2009/07/12(日) 22:55:44 ID:??? (+26,-30,-23)
    もうさ、いい加減テンプレにdisplay_errorsとerror_reportingについて載せようぜ
    479 : nobodyさん - 2009/07/13(月) 00:45:29 ID:??? (+49,+23,+0)
    >>478
    反対のハンタイなのだ
    480 : nobodyさん - 2009/07/13(月) 10:49:55 ID:??? (+110,+29,-43)
    >>424
    文章の流れからするとそれっぽいんだけど、

    >例えば「cの前にbがついていると無効」みたいな設定が出来て
    >「bc」のみを取得したい

    って、「bcがないときにbcを取得したい」って読めるんだよ。
    俺が馬鹿なだけだったらすまん。
    481 : nobodyさん - 2009/07/13(月) 10:51:21 ID:??? (+69,+25,-2)
    >>480
    すまんアンカーミス。
    >>426だな。
    483 : nobodyさん - 2009/07/13(月) 12:43:59 ID:??? (+34,+6,-35)
    GD側でBMP対応させてないと無理だろう
    別にユーザー関数でいいじゃない?
    484 : nobodyさん - 2009/07/13(月) 14:37:17 ID:??? (+29,-29,-43)
    クラスのメソッドに、標準関数と同じ名前は定義しちゃいけないの?
    動作はするのにEclipseがエラー吐くのでキモイです…。

    $user->list();
    みたいな。
    485 : 484 - 2009/07/13(月) 14:41:02 ID:dllOgc2X (-21,+28,+1)
    sageてしまいたいへんうんこでした申し訳ないです。
    486 : nobodyさん - 2009/07/13(月) 15:47:57 ID:??? (+82,+29,-52)
    自宅鯖にphpブログを設置して設置できてるかの確認までは問題なかったんですけど
    管理者画面に入ろうとすると真っ白なページが一瞬読み込まれてその後トップページに戻ってしまいます。
    ここで質問することなのか分かりませんがどなたか助けてくださいませんか?
    488 : nobodyさん - 2009/07/13(月) 15:54:47 ID:??? (-12,-3,-5)
    webサーバのログに何かでてない?
    489 : nobodyさん - 2009/07/13(月) 15:58:04 ID:??? (+29,+29,-60)
    使ったことないしソース読まないから勘だけど
    管理画面ってことはクッキーまわりとかじゃないのかな
    クッキー発行できなかったらトップに飛ばす処理とかしてそう
    ((まぁ普通はクッキーONにしてくださいって出すだろうから違うかもしれないけど)
    ブラウザの設定は問題ない?
    491 : nobodyさん - 2009/07/13(月) 16:20:00 ID:??? (-25,-28,-100)
    >>484
    設定でどうにかなるか知らないけどEclipseの設定でどうにか汁
    とりあえず定義しちゃいけないなんてことはない
    ただ避けたほうがいいとは思う
    何をするメソッドか知らないけどlistってメソッド名はちょっとどうかと思う
    set get add append remove clear findとか前になんかつけたほうがいいんじゃないかと思う
    493 : nobodyさん - 2009/07/13(月) 17:25:30 ID:??? (-14,-29,-20)
    >>490
    見慣れないメッセージとおもってググったらAnHTTPDでWindowsかい。
    環境詳しく書いてくれ。
    494 : nobodyさん - 2009/07/13(月) 17:47:02 ID:OhNG2SXC (-17,+28,-49)
    >>493
    winXPSP3+AnHTTPD+PHP5.3です
    winでの鯖運用はトラブルが多いと言われているのは知っていたんですが、
    気まぐれではじめたものでしたので、、それにまさかこんな小さなことでもトラブるとは思ってませんでしたorz
    ブログはレンタルサーバではじめようと思います これ以上はスレ違いになりそうですし、、
    495 : nobodyさん - 2009/07/13(月) 18:06:43 ID:??? (-6,-29,-59)
    PHPでCGIエラーというのがよくわからんがAnHTTPDだとそういう動作なのかなあ
    まあレンタルサーバではすんなり動くと思うし使い方、設置の質問だとスレ違いな気も。
    496 : nobodyさん - 2009/07/13(月) 18:14:17 ID:OhNG2SXC (-20,+29,-5)
    >>495
    ですよね。スレ汚し申し訳なかったです。
    レスしてくださった方々ありがとうございました。
    497 : nobodyさん - 2009/07/13(月) 19:27:58 ID:??? (+65,-23,-94)
    どこのサービスでもやってる、メアド入れてユーザー登録→確認メールが届く→一定時間内にメールに書いてあるURLをクリックすると登録完了→ユーザー名&パスワードでログイン
    というのを簡単に実装できるライブラリみたいのないでしょうか?
    ぐぐったらありそうだったけど見つからなかったので
    498 : nobodyさん - 2009/07/13(月) 19:37:34 ID:??? (+60,+26,-13)
    >>497
    CMSならそういうの実装しているものが多い。
    499 : nobodyさん - 2009/07/13(月) 19:57:05 ID:??? (+52,+29,-14)
    自分で実装してみるのも勉強になるよ
    500 : nobodyさん - 2009/07/13(月) 21:04:13 ID:??? (+45,+8,-15)
    >>497
    そういうのを楽にやりたいならフレームワーク(CMS含む)
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itterで / php スレッド一覧へ
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。

    類似してるかもしれないスレッド


    トップメニューへ / →のくす牧場書庫について